Downloaded from www.Manualslib.com manuals search engine The electronics and computerization which were
pioneered by Cadillac in the
’70s came of age in the
’80s with Digital Fuel Injection and On-Board
Diagnostics in 1980, four wheel Anti-lock Brakes on
1986..models and Traction Control in the fall
of 1989.
The 1992 Seville
STS was the first car ever to win all
three major automotive awards: Car of the Year, Motor
Trend; Ten Best List, Car
& Driver; Car of the Year,
Automobile Magazine.
The year 1993 saw the introduction of the Northstar
system. The state
of the art system includes the 32 valve,
dual overhead camshaft, Northstar 4.6 liter
V8 engine,
4T80-E electronically controlled automatic transaxle,
road sensing suspension, speed sensitive steering, anti-lock brakes and traction control.

REVERSE (R): Use this gear to back up.
NOTICE:
Shifting to REVERSE (R) while your vehicle is
moving forward could damage your transaxle.
Shift to REVERSE
(R) only after your vehicle
has stopped.
NEUTRAL (N): In this position, the engine doesn’t
connect with the wheels. To restart when you’re
already moving, use NEUTRAL (N) only. Also, use
NEUTRAL
(N) when your vehicle is being towed.

Downloaded from www.Manualslib.com manuals search engine OVERDRIVE (a): This position is for normal driving.
If you need more power for passing, and you’re:
Going less than 35 mph (55 kmk), push the
accelerator pedal about halfway down.
Going about 35 mph (55 kmh) or more, push the
accelerator all the way down.
The transaxle will shift down to the next gear and
have more power.

Parking Brake
Hold the regular brake
pedal down with your right
foot and push down the
parking brake pedal with
your left foot to set the
parking brake. If the
ignition is on, the PARK
BRAKE indicator light
should come on.
If it
doesn’t, you need to have
your vehicle serviced.
If the parking brake has not been fully released and you
try to drive off with the parking brake on, the PARK
BRAKE indicator light comes on and stays on. See “Parking Brake Indicator Light” in the Index for
more information.
When you move out of PARK
(P) or NEUTRAL (N),
if the engine is running, the parking brake should
release. If it doesn’t, you can manually release the
parking brake.

With cruise control, you can maintain a speed of about 25
mph (40 km/h) or more without keeping your foot on the
accelerator.
This can help on long trips. Cruise control
does not work at speeds below
25 mph (40 M).
Cruise control shuts off when you apply your brakes.
2-39
Page 112 of 386
Downloaded from www.Manualslib.com manuals search engine Reducing Speed While Using Cruise Control
There are two ways to reduce your speed while using
cruise control:
Push in the button at the end of the lever until you
reach a desired lower speed, then release it.
A
CRUISE ENGAGED message will then display in
the Driver Information Center (DIC).
To slow down in very small amounts, push the
button for less than half a second. Each time you do
this, you’ll go
1 mph (1.6 km/h) slower.
Passing Another Vehicle While Using Cruise Control
Use the accelerator pedal to increase your speed. When
you take your foot
off the pedal, your vehicle will slow
down to the cruise control speed you set earlier.
Using Cruise Control on Hills
How well your cruise control will work on hills depends
upon your speed, load and the steepness of the hills.
When going up steep hills, you may have to step on the
accelerator pedal
to maintain your speed. When going
downhill, you may have to brake or shift to. a lower gear to keep your speed down. Of course, applying the brakes
or downshifting into FIRST
(1) takes you out of cruise
control. Many drivers find this to be too much trouble
and don’t use cruise control on steep hills.
Ending Cruise Control
There are two ways to end cruise control:
Step lightly on the brake pedal.
Move the CRUISE switch to OFF.
Erasing Speed Memory
The cruise control set speed memory is erased when you
turn
off the cruise control or the ignition.
